]> git.proxmox.com Git - mirror_ubuntu-bionic-kernel.git/blobdiff - include/linux/blk-mq.h
blk-mq: implement new and more efficient tagging scheme
[mirror_ubuntu-bionic-kernel.git] / include / linux / blk-mq.h
index 5bd677e2dcb726b4cba82f08374256d35a3f2676..f83d15f6e1c1846c88f76f60dd471b39c5c1bfa4 100644 (file)
@@ -31,10 +31,12 @@ struct blk_mq_hw_ctx {
 
        void                    *driver_data;
 
-       unsigned int            nr_ctx;
-       struct blk_mq_ctx       **ctxs;
        unsigned int            nr_ctx_map;
        unsigned long           *ctx_map;
+       unsigned int            nr_ctx;
+       struct blk_mq_ctx       **ctxs;
+
+       unsigned int            wait_index;
 
        struct blk_mq_tags      *tags;